Lee Myles Transmissions & Autocare

Share:Lee Myles Transmissions & Autocare

Headings:

Automobile - Repairs & Services, Transmissions Automobile Repairing

Latitude:25.641512 Longitude:-80.413877
13559 SW 137th Ave
Miami, FL 33186